   To run a Java application we need to know name of a `.class` file with the 
`main()` method. This change introduces logic to reliably locate such file 
using `javap` tool.
   
   We cannot rely on `IsMain` metadata argument, available for multi-file 
examples, as we have no way of knowing names of the generated `.class` files 
without parsing the source code to a significant degree, as Java compiler 
produces one such file for each class definition in the source `.java` file 
with names corresponding to the name of the class defined in the source code.
   We also cannot rely on the convention that the Java source file name should 
be the same as the name of a public class defined in that `.java` file because 
[we trim 
all](https://github.com/apache/beam/blob/0b8f0b4db7a0de4977e30bcfeb50b5c14c7c1572/playground/backend/internal/preparers/java_preparers.go#L61)
 `public` keywords from class definitions.
